Agricultural Consultant: As an agricultural consultant, you will provide expert advice and support to farmers, landowners, and rural businesses. Your expertise will help clients improve their productivity, profitability, and sustainability. Farm Manager: Farm managers oversee the day-to-day operations of a farm or estate. They are responsible for maximising efficiency, profitability, and environmental sustainability, while ensuring high standards of animal welfare and food safety. Agricultural Engineer: Agricultural engineers design, develop, and maintain agricultural machinery, equipment, and structures. They work on projects ranging from farm machinery and irrigation systems to rural buildings and renewable energy systems. Sales Representative (Agri-inputs): Sales representatives in the agri-input sector promote and sell a range of farm inputs, such as seeds, fertilisers, pesticides, and machinery. They build strong relationships with farmers, dealers, and other stakeholders to ensure customer satisfaction and drive sales. Policy Analyst (Agriculture): Policy analysts in agriculture help shape government policies and regulations that affect the agricultural sector. They conduct research, analyse data, and engage with stakeholders to provide informed recommendations and advice. Agricultural Journalist: Agricultural journalists cover news, trends, and developments in the agricultural sector. They write for newspapers, magazines, websites, and other media outlets, providing insight and analysis on the industry. Procurement Specialist (Agri-business): Procurement specialists in agri-business are responsible for sourcing raw materials, equipment, and services for their organisation. They negotiate contracts, manage relationships with suppliers, and ensure that procurement processes align with company goals and strategies.
